Selecting a Professional Calibration Lab for Australian Industry Standards

Industrial precision isn't optional. For businesses operating across Sydney and Melbourne, a professional calibration lab acts as the primary safeguard against equipment drift and regulatory failure. This process ensures that every measurement taken on a worksite or in a laboratory aligns with national standards. We define this through traceability, a documented chain of comparisons linking your equipment back to the SI units maintained by the National Measurement Institute. Before committing to a service, it's vital to understand What is Calibration? and how it differs from basic maintenance. While a standard repair shop might fix a broken component, only a certified laboratory provides the metrological rigor needed to guarantee accuracy within specified tolerances.

Climate Control and Vibration Isolation

Australian climate extremes, where outdoor temperatures often exceed 40°C in summer, create significant challenges for unshielded measurement processes. Thermal expansion can alter a component's dimensions by microns, rendering pressure and electrical calibrations invalid if not performed in a stable setting. At Zenith Instruments, we maintain our Sydney and Melbourne facilities at a constant 20°C with a maximum variance of ±1°C. Humidity levels are strictly capped at 50% with a ±5% tolerance. We also utilize specialized vibration isolation tables to prevent seismic interference from heavy machinery or nearby traffic, ensuring that measurement uncertainty remains at its absolute minimum. Equipment and Reference Standards

We maintain a strict hierarchy of metrology to ensure ongoing accuracy. This begins with our primary master standards, which are high-accuracy instruments used exclusively to verify our own working standards. These working standards are then used to calibrate your everyday equipment. We perform internal verifications every 30 days to detect even the slightest drift in performance, ensuring our calibration lab remains within its scope of accreditation. Essential Compliance: ISO/IEC 17025 and Regulatory Requirements

ISO/IEC 17025 is the international benchmark for technical competence in a calibration lab. It ensures that we maintain a documented quality management system and produce results that are technically valid. We recognize a critical distinction between "traceable" and "NATA-accredited" certification. While traceable certificates link your equipment to national standards, a NATA-accredited certificate provides the highest level of legal and technical assurance. The NATA Badge: What it Means for Your Business

NATA accreditation is more than a logo; it's a guarantee of precision. We undergo biennial peer-review assessments where technical experts scrutinize our methodology and equipment. This rigorous process ensures our facilities in Sydney, Melbourne, Brisbane, and Perth operate with identical precision. Because NATA is a signatory to the ILAC Mutual Recognition Arrangement, your Zenith-certified equipment is recognized in 104 different economies worldwide. This global acceptance is vital for Australian manufacturers exporting precision components to international markets.

Managing Calibration Cycles and Recertification

Instruments naturally lose accuracy over time. This phenomenon, known as "drift," can lead to a 12% measurement error within a single year for high-use pressure or temperature sensors. We help you determine the optimal frequency for recertification based on manufacturer specifications and your specific usage patterns. What documentation will I receive after my equipment is calibrated?

You'll receive a detailed NATA-endorsed calibration certificate or a traceable compliance report for every instrument. These documents provide the "as-found" and "as-left" data, along with calculated measurement uncertainties. Our reports meet all requirements for ISO 9001 audits and safety inspections.
